Application

Fluorescent label for saccharides and glycoproteins.[1]
APTS is a fluorescence reagent that has been demonstrated to have a high level of detection sensitivity for sugars The LOD for APTS-derivatized sugars has been shown to be 0.4 nM when using a 488 nm argon-ion laser. The multi-anionic nature of APTS makes it ideal for the studies of carbohydrate molecules and small hormone molecules by high resolution capillary electrophoresis.
Fluorescent label for glycoproteins and saccharides.
